Ingredients french puree or mashed potatoes
1 kg medium potatoes peeled and cut into slices lengthwise
1 cup milk
90 g butter
ground nutmeg
salt
how to make french puree or mashed potatoes
Place the potatoes in a saucepan, cover it with water, add a pinch of salt and cook on medium heat for about 20 minutes.
When the potatoes are cooked, remove from heat and drain completely.
In a bowl, add in a milk, a pinch of nutmeg, salt and mix well.
Mash well the potatoes with a fork (or a potato masher if you have one), then place them in a saucepan over low heat. Slowly add in the milk mixture, and the butter. Stir until it is well mixed around 3 minutes. Taste and adjust seasoning.
Transfer the mashed potatoes to a serving dish and eat hot as a side dish with a grilled steak or chicken fillet.
